About ShiftKey

ShiftKey is a platform that is disrupting the way healthcare facilities find licensed and certified professionals to fill available shifts. Leveraging marketplace dynamics and deep industry knowledge, the company is playing a vital role in mitigating America’s healthcare staffing shortages, enabling direct connections between facilities and healthcare professionals. By offering the opportunity to work as much or as little as they choose and putting the power back into the hands of healthcare workers, ShiftKey is bringing more licensed professionals back into the workforce, a solution that is solving a major crisis in healthcare. The role

We're looking for a Director of Platform & Infrastructure to lead the platform and infrastructure function supporting our SaaS and Marketplace engineering organizations. This is a hands-on infrastructure leadership role, leading a distributed team of roughly 10 people spanning multiple regions and time zones, including a dedicated SRE-focused group.

Where you’ll work

This is a fully remote position based in the United States. You should be comfortable working asynchronously and partnering with teammates in different time zones.

What you’ll be doing

  • Lead and grow a distributed platform and infrastructure organization, staying hands-on with the team when issues arise.

  • Drive infrastructure modernization and cloud migration initiatives, including moving services to managed cloud offerings.

  • Own reliability, deployment, and disaster recovery practices across the organization's core environments.

  • Set engineering standards for infrastructure automation, CI/CD, and operational resilience.

  • Partner with engineering and senior leadership to translate platform strategy into practical roadmaps.

What you’ll need

  • Significant experience leading technical or engineering teams.

  • Strong hands-on experience with a major cloud provider and modern infrastructure practices.

  • A track record leading and developing teams, including through incidents and high-pressure situations.

  • Experience working in a product-driven technology company.

  • Comfort leading distributed, cross-regional teams.

  • A direct, people-first leadership style focused on team growth and hands-on support.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
